Usually. But in the very first episode, Vic (with Shane attendant) murdered a fed who was posing as a member of their strike team to try to nail them. Vic and Co. were deep into a lot of corruption, taking money from certain gangs and drug dealers in order to line their own pockets while also keeping the streets “orderly.”
Things began to heat up, the Strike Team was disbanded and while Vic and the others more or less walked the straight and narrow, Shane delved ever deeper into the shadow world…until he got caught up in a nightmare with a particular gang leader last season and was framed for murder. After Vic got him out of that, he has also been more on the straight and narrow path, although Vic and the rest often break or bend the law to dispense “street justice.”
To rundown the episode:
Vic lets the rest of the team know that Lem is under survielance from I.A.B. The team uses the laptop to communicate with Lem so nothing is heard.
Vic tells Shane that Lem knows about Terry.
Vic tells Lem that Terry was killed by the dealers, but that it was Vic’s fault for not being careful enough during the raid, so that Kavanaugh will hear this over the mic.
Vic and the team bust the child slave ring with the help of newbie hottie detective, who is put in some very compromising positions while under cover.
Dutch almost goes out with a gay guy.
Vic and his Ex figure out that Kavanaugh is the guy that has been meeting her at their kids’ school. She asks Vic if there is anything she needs to cover up, and he says “of course not”.
I think that covers the main points.
